Discerning Truth in an AI-Influenced World
Discerning truth from falsehood is a paramount skill for every learner, especially in the age of generative AI.
At the University of Michigan-Dearborn, we are proud to introduce the Curate and SIFT common assignment initiative—inspired by our 2024 common read Verified by Mike Caulfield and Sam Wineburg.
The common assignment is being piloted over the summer by a small group of faculty who plan to research their teaching practice and share their findings as a Scholarship of Teaching and Learning (SoTL) project.
There are also plans for Foundations faculty to adopt the assignment, events to share out experiences, and more.
